Highlights
- Dover spends 3.1% more per student than St. Louis Park.
- The Student Teacher Ratio is 22.8% lower in Dover than in St. Louis Park. (lower means fewer students in each classroom).
- Dover had 2.6% fewer residents who had graduated High School compared to St. Louis Park
